A man was taken to hospital with serious injuries to his head and body after being attacked on a West Lothian street in broad daylight.

The 23-year-old victim was walking on Riddochhill Road in Blackburn at around 11.30am on Friday, November 5.

A man got out of a Ford Transit and seriously assaulted him badly injuring him before leaving in the van.

The victim was taken to St John’s Hospital for treatment.

The suspect is described as around 5ft 11in, of stocky build, wearing black tracksuit top and bottoms. He has a Scottish accent.

Police have appealed to the public for help and urged any witnesses to come forward.

Detective constable David McDougall, of Livingston CID, said: “The victim is now at home recovering from his injuries and we are carrying out enquiries to trace the man responsible.

“He is described as being around 5ft 11in in height, of stocky build, he had Scottish accent and was wearing a black tracksuit top and black tracksuit bottoms. He then left the area in a Ford Transit.

“I would appeal to anyone who was in the area at the time and witnessed the assault or anyone who has information that will assist this investigation to contact us through 101 quoting reference number 1195 of Friday, November 5.

“Alternatively Crimestoppers can be contacted on 0800 555 111, where anonymity can be maintained.”
